If you push them too far once you have saved the settings it will keep restarting so you just enter the bios again and change it.

But sometimes it restarts and goes to like stand by mode and you cant do anything so you have to turn the pc off take the bios battery out and that should reset it self or reset the jumpers.
 
They have thermal throttling, if that's what you mean. When they get too hot they revert to a "limp-home" sort of mode where they drastically slow themselves down to keep from burning up.
